Major fraud at temple IT centre
A computer training centre situated at a Buddhist Temple in Kiripitiya-Kurunegala was allegedly a front for major fraud, a police raid earlier this morning has found out. According to police the computer training centre set up under the ‘Mahinda Chintana’ programme was mainly for the use of children from low-income families in the village, but instead it was turning out fake driving licenses, national identity cards, currency notes and a host of pornographic material. The king pin behind the sordid racket was the chief priest of the temple who was subsequently taken into custody. Police are currently investigating the extent of the racket and are convinced that several more persons may have assisted the monk in the illegal; activities. Several computers, soft ware, printers and other material used in the centre were also seized by police. The Kiripitiya Police are conducting further investigations.
